Corporate Transactions
Tax structuring for clients involved in mergers and acquisitions
is an important part of Orrick’s extensive corporate tax
planning capability. Tax Department lawyers have been involved
in domestic and international transactions involving purchases
and acquisitions, business combinations and divestitures, corporate
restructuring such as recapitalizations, multi-tier spin-offs
and split-offs and hybrid entities, and innovative transactions
involving the consolidated return regulations.
Our lawyers are involved daily in providing corporate tax
consultations to the tax departments of many of the largest
publicly held companies. The Department also provides corporate
and shareholder tax planning for closely held corporations ranging
from mid-size companies to the very largest.
Illustrative corporate transactions where we have provided
extensive tax advice include:
- REIT Acquisitions. Orrick represented
RREEF as advisor to CalPERS in its $2 billion acquisition
of Cabot Industrial PropertiesTrust, a publicly-traded REIT,
and to another public pension plan on the acquisition of a
private REIT. Orrick also represented Layton-Belling &
Associates in its organization of a real estate fund, including
a private REIT structure, and AMB Properties in its organization
of a joint venture structure using a private REIT.
- PG&E Corporation. Orrick has been
a long-time tax advisor to PG&E Corporation, providing
advice regarding many of the corporation’s activities,
including restructuring into a holding company with internal
spin-offs of non-utility assets, “Morris Trust”
acquisition of natural gas operations of Valero Energy Corporation,
termination of its joint venture with Bechtel Corporation,
the restructuring and buyout of power purchase agreements,
and most recently, the plan for restructuring of its utility
subsidiary.
- Varian Associates, Inc. Orrick counseled
this company with respect to tax issues related to its spin-off
of two operating divisions into separate public companies
and the sale of other business units, leaving the company
as Varian Medical Systems, Inc., to operate as a pure?play
medical equipment company.
